## Changelog — Vettrix baseline defaults

The static-analysis baseline file is now regenerated on every release branch cut instead of weekly. Suppressions older than 90 days expire automatically. New findings against main block merge by default. If the gate misfires overnight, disable strict mode rather than editing the baseline by hand. Active settings follow.

service settings:
PRAIX_LOG_LEVEL=error
PRAIX_METRICS_HOST=metrics.praix.qorvelcorp.corp
PRAIX_POOL_SIZE=16

## Deploying the Gatewick Proctor Queue

Deploys are pretty painless: push to main, wait for the pipeline, then watch the queue drain dashboard for five minutes. If candidates pile up mid-exam, roll back first and ask questions later — the queue replays safely. Everything the workers care about lives in one config block, shown here for reference.

settings of bafof-yagef:
JOROX_PIN=8740
JOROX_TENANT=pelox
JOROX_METRICS_HOST=metrics.jorox.qorvelworks.internal
JOROX_SEAL=seal_c78f63c1
JOROX_STANDBY_TEAM=norax

## Step 7: Verify nightly reindex settings

Before approving this change, please confirm that the Saltgrass search service's nightly reindex job points at the new Brindlewood index cluster and that batch sizes match what capacity planning approved. A mismatch here caused the March slowdown. The values the job should run with after this migration are listed below.

config for bahof-tagep:
kelael:
  pin: 3701
  tenant: fraius
  seal: seal_566287a7
  metrics_host: metrics.kelael.ferradyn.local
  standby_team: sormir
  escalation: juldor-oliir
  nonce: 530523